The National Bank of Moldova held for the first time “Career Week at the NBM”

 

During the period 04-08 December 2023, the National Bank of Moldova (NBM) held/hosted “Career Week at the NBM” for the first time. These events were organised for the first time in educational institutions across the country. The events were dedicated to both professional in the financial-banking field and young people focused on professional development, especially students and Master's students at economic and financial faculties.

More than 130 participants visited us or watched our live broadcasts on the first day of the week. They participated in a panel discussion with former NBM interns and attended thematic workshops with experts from the central bank, while getting acquainted with job positions and the employment process within the NBM.

Over the next three days of the week, teams of experts from the NBM visited universities across the country, interacting daily with students and Master's students and providing them with relevant information on the central bank's areas of activity such as: banking supervision; reporting and statistics; budget, finance, and accounting; information technology and online security; financial markets and financial stability. At the same time, the participants learned what steps they need to take to apply for an internship at the NBM. They also found out about the vacancies at the NBM and how to apply for the employment competitions within the institution.

The event ended with a unique action, in which 9 of the most studious Master’s students and students from the Academy of Economic Studies of Moldova, Technical University of Moldova, State University of Moldova, Centre of Excellence in Economics and Finance and Iulia Hasdeu College from Cahul spent one day at the National Bank of Moldova. The 9 competition winners visited our bank, engaged in discussions with the Governor and other members of the NBM team, and gained a close understanding of the institution’s areas of activity.

Career Week at the NBM continued the series of similar events that are organised in collaboration with higher education institutions in the country.
